Question 282: To ask the Minister for Education and Skills the reasons teaching experience abroad is not recognised here which would allow teachers to be included on the supplementary panel;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[25079/12]

The eligibility terms for access to the supplementary panel are based on a teacher's service in the primary school system in a fixed term, substitute and part-time capacity. There are no plans to expand these arrangements to include teaching experience in schools outside of Ireland. The detailed arrangements are set out in my Department's Circular 0012/2012 which is available on my Department's website.
